If you can attend a FEW email rachael@ebatesville.com for consideration.\nDates:\nSept.19\, Sept. 26\, Oct. 3\, Oct. 17\, Oct. 24\nTime: 10am – 12pm\nLife drawing is accessible to all\, fun and rewarding. It helps participants see the world with an artist’s eye. It teaches hand-eye coordination\, hones observational skills\, and does wonders for relaxation through releasing attachment to perfection and finding a new connection within our brain. \nDuring a life drawing session\, a clothed model is surrounded by participants and the instructor. The model poses for different durations. Some popular mediums used during life drawings are charcoal\, graphite\, pen\, ink and/or pastels. We will start with the basics and work our way through a variety of mediums. \nThe great thing about Life Drawing is that in just one class\, you can see a marked change – if not in your drawings\, in your perspective. In five classes\, improvements will be very obvious. To highlight this progress and to treat the participants as real artists\, the final class will be a gallery-style show. This is a FREE open to the community book discussion and books can be checked out for reading at: Tyson\, Osgood or Batesville Libraries before the discussion to read.\nLocation: Tyson Library\nTime: 5:00pm\n  \nThis program has been made possible through a grant from Indiana Humanities in cooperation with the National Endowment for the Humanities. \nWinner of the 2021 National Book Award in nonfiction\, Miles’ work dives deeply into the history of a single object: a cotton sack embroidered with a few deceptively simple lines: \nMy great grandmother Rose\nmother of Ashley gave her this sack when\nshe was sold at age 9 in South Carolina\nit held a tattered dress 3 handfulls of\npecans a braid of Roses hair. Told her\nIt be filled with my Love always\nshe never saw her again\nAshley is my grandmother \nRuth Middleton \n1921 \nFrom the sparse information contained in these carefully embroidered lines\, Miles opens up the potential worlds of Ashley\, Ruth\, and Rose. Her analysis of the sack reveals what we can and can’t know about the past\, particularly of Black individuals who were brought here by force and enslaved. \nBOOK: All That She Carried by Tiya Miles\nBOOK SUMMARY: In 1850s South Carolina\, an enslaved woman named Rose faced a crisis: the imminent sale of her daughter Ashley. Thinking quickly\, she packed a cotton bag for her with a few items\, and\, soon after\, the nine-year-old girl was separated from her mother and sold. Decades later\, Ashley’s granddaughter Ruth embroidered this family history on the sack in spare\, haunting language. \n  \nComplete information can be found at https://ripleycountyreads.org/osos/

DESCRIPTION:Black Quilters: Hard Topics\, Soft Blows\n\nSeptember 9 @ 6:00 pm – 7:00 pm at Batesville Library\n\n\n\nThis program coordinated with the 2024 One State/ One Story All That She Carried: The Journey of Ashley’s Sack\, a Black Family Keepsake by Tiya Miles sponsored by the Indiana Humanities. \nThough often dismissed as “women’s work” and regulated to the realm of handicrafts\, the art of quilting holds a prominent place in many cultures. It brings together communities and allows creators to chronicle their struggles and triumphs. Join Dr. Tony Jean Dickerson as she discusses the artistry of African American quilters and the stories they tell in their works. While she will blend her presentation to coordinate with the book\, knowledge/reading of the book is not required to attend.  \nDr. Dickerson is the lead faculty for Martin University’s School of Education’s Teacher Preparation Program as of June 2022. Besides teaching\, Dr. Dickerson is a nationally recognized quilter and is a member of 8 local and national quilt guilds including the founding president of the Akoma Ntoso Modern Quilt Guild of Central Indiana.
